Background
Principle of air flotation process the air flotation process is a high-efficient fast method of separating solid particle from water and waste water, its working principle is that a part of treated waste water circulates and flows into dissolving the gas pitcher, under the pressurized air state, the air supersaturation dissolves, then mix with raw water of adding flocculating agent at the entrance of the air flotation pool, because the pressure reduces, the supersaturated air is released, form the tiny bubble, attach to the suspended solid rapidly, promote it to the surface of the air flotation pool, however, the existing air flotation device for urban sewage treatment has many problems or defects:
firstly, the existing air floatation device for treating the urban sewage has poor air floatation effect and low practicability;
secondly, the existing air floatation device for treating the urban sewage does not treat wastes floating on the water surface, so that the practicability is not strong;
thirdly, the existing air flotation device for treating the urban sewage does not treat the waste at the bottom inside the device, and the practicability is not strong.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-6, the present invention provides an embodiment: an air floatation device for urban sewage treatment comprises a medicine box 2, a treatment box 13, a waste box 16 and a purification box 17, wherein support legs 10 are fixedly arranged at the bottom of the purification box 17 through screws, the medicine box 2 is arranged at the top of the purification box 17, a medicine inlet 3 is arranged at one side of the top of the medicine box 2, a protective door 20 is movably connected to the outside of the purification box 17 through a shaft, a control panel 21 is fixedly arranged at one side of the outside of the protective door 20 through screws, a single chip microcomputer 22 is embedded in the control panel 21, and the treatment box 13 is arranged at one side of the inside of the purification box 17;
one end of the purification box 17 is connected with a water inlet pipe 6, the other end of the purification box 17 is connected with a water outlet pipe 8, the other end of the water inlet pipe 6 is connected to the inside of the treatment box 13, and the other end of the water outlet pipe 8 is connected to the inside of the treatment box 13;
a chute 14 is arranged at the bottom of one side of the purification box 17 close to the treatment box 13, a sliding block 15 is arranged in the chute 14 in a sliding manner, and a waste box 16 is arranged at the top of the sliding block 15;
an air floatation pipe 11 is fixedly arranged in the treatment box 13 through a screw, and an air floatation opening 12 is formed in the top of the air floatation pipe 11;
a pump body 4 is arranged on one side of the top of the purifying box 17, one end of the pump body 4 is connected to the inside of the medicine box 2, the other end of the pump body 4 is connected with a connecting pipe 5, and the other end of the connecting pipe 5 is connected to the bottom of the air floating pipe 11;
the inside of the treatment box 13 is provided with the stirring blade 7 through a bearing, the outside of the purification box 17 is fixedly provided with a third motor 24 through a screw, and one end of the third motor 24 is connected with one end of the stirring blade 7 through a coupling;
when the air floatation device is used, the pump body 4 is started, the pump body 4 pumps out the internal medicament of the medicament box 2, the medicament is subjected to air floatation from the air floatation port 12 to the treatment box 13, the third motor 24 is started, the third motor 24 drives the stirring blades 7 to rotate, and the stirring blades 7 mix the medicament, so that the aim of good air floatation effect is fulfilled;
a discharging device 9 is arranged on one side inside the purifying box 17, and the other end of the discharging device 9 extends into the processing box 13;
a rotating wheel 18 is arranged in the treatment box 13 close to the top through a shaft, a conveying belt 19 is arranged on the rotating wheel 18, a scraping claw 1 is arranged on the conveying belt 19, a second motor 23 is fixedly arranged on one side of the outer part of the purification box 17 through a screw, and one end of the second motor 23 is connected with one end of the rotating wheel 18 through a coupling;
when the air floatation type waste treatment device is used, air floatation waste floats on the water surface, the second motor 23 drives the rotating wheel 18 to rotate by starting the second motor 23, the rotating wheel 18 drives the conveying belt 19 to rotate, the conveying belt 19 drives the scraping claw 1 to rotate, and the scraping claw 1 brings the waste into the waste box 16, so that the purpose of waste treatment is achieved;
a discharge barrel 901, a first motor 902, a first belt wheel 903, a second belt wheel 904, a waste outlet 905, a rotating shaft 906 and a spiral piece 907 are sequentially arranged in the discharge device 9, the discharge barrel 901 is arranged on one side of the purification box 17, the rotating shaft 906 is movably arranged in the discharge barrel 901 through a bearing, the spiral piece 907 is arranged outside the rotating shaft 906, the first motor 902 is arranged on one side of the top of the discharge barrel 901, one end of the first motor 902 is connected with the first belt wheel 903 through a coupler, one end of the rotating shaft 906 is connected with the second belt wheel 904, the first belt wheel 903 is connected with one end of the second belt wheel 904 through a belt, and the waste outlet 905 is connected to the bottom of the discharge barrel 901;
during the use, through starting first motor 902, first motor 902 will drive first band pulley 903 and rotate, and first band pulley 903 will drive second band pulley 904 and rotate, and second band pulley 904 will drive rotation axis 906 and rotate, and rotation axis 906 will drive flight 907 and rotate, and flight 907 will be the rubbish effluvium to the convenient purpose of waste treatment has been realized.
The output end of the control panel 21 is electrically connected with the input end of the single chip microcomputer 22 through a lead, the output end of the single chip microcomputer 22 is electrically connected with the input ends of the first motor 902, the second motor 23, the third motor 24 and the pump body 4 through leads, the model of the single chip microcomputer 22 can be HT66F018, the model of the first motor 902 can be Y90S-2, the model of the second motor 23 can be Y90L-2, the model of the third motor 24 can be Y80M1-2, and the model of the pump body 4 can be JYQW.
The working principle is as follows: when the device is used, the device is placed at a proper position, each pipeline is connected to work, then wastewater enters the inside of the treatment box 13, the pump body 4 is started to pump out the internal medicament of the medicine box 2, the medicament is floated in the treatment box 13 through the air floatation port 12, the third motor 24 is started to drive the stirring blades 7 to rotate, the stirring blades 7 mix the medicament by the aid of the third motor 24, the purpose of good air floatation effect is achieved, the air-floated waste floats on the water surface, the second motor 23 is started to drive the rotating wheel 18 to rotate, the rotating wheel 18 drives the conveyor belt 19 to rotate, the conveyor belt 19 drives the scraping claw 1 to rotate, the scraping claw 1 brings the waste into the waste box 16, the purpose of waste treatment is achieved, and after the wastewater is treated by the conventional device, a part of the waste sinks to the bottom, therefore, when the waste disposal device is used, the first motor 902 drives the first belt pulley 903 to rotate by starting the first motor 902, the first belt pulley 903 drives the second belt pulley 904 to rotate, the second belt pulley 904 drives the rotating shaft 906 to rotate, the rotating shaft 906 drives the spiral piece 907 to rotate, and the spiral piece 907 rotates the waste, so that the purpose of convenience in waste disposal is achieved.
